Fire Alarm Engineer

CV-Library Cardiff

Description

    Fire Alarm Engineer

    Location
    Cardiff

    Salary or rate
    £40,000 per annum

    About the role

    We are looking for an experienced Fire Alarm Engineer to join our team based in Cardiff. This Fire Alarm Engineer position offers the opportunity to work on a single site throughout the year as part of an established fire protection team, carrying out service, maintenance, commissioning, and remedial works across a range of gaseous fire suppression and fire alarm systems.

    As a Fire Alarm Engineer, you will be responsible for maintaining high standards of safety, quality, and customer service while working both independently and alongside experienced colleagues. This Fire Alarm Engineer role involves working with systems including IG55, FM200, Novec 1230, CO2, and fire alarm panels, ensuring systems remain compliant and fully operational. If you are an experienced Fire Alarm Engineer looking to develop your career within a supportive environment, this is an excellent opportunity.

    Key responsibilities

    • Service, maintain, and undertake minor repairs to fire alarm systems.

    • Support the delivery of work across multiple fire protection disciplines including sprinklers, deluge systems, foam systems, fire extinguishers, and fire doors.

    • Accurately record service activities, job timings, and all relevant documentation using company provided systems.

    • Identify system faults and deficiencies, providing clear reports and recommendations.

    • Act as the main point of contact on site, delivering a professional customer experience.

    • Comply with all QEHS requirements, risk assessments, method statements, and company procedures.

    • Support and mentor less experienced team members where required.

    Skills and experience required

    Essential

    • Carry out planned preventative maintenance, routine servicing, and remedial works on gaseous suppression systems including IG55, FM200, and CO2 systems.

    • Proven experience servicing and maintaining fire alarm systems.

    • Good understanding of current fire suppression standards, legislation, and industry best practice.

    • Experience working within a customer focused service environment.

    • Full UK driving licence.

    Desirable

    • FIA, BAFE, manufacturer training, or other relevant industry qualifications.

    • Previous experience servicing and maintaining gaseous suppression systems including one or more of IG55, FM200, Novec 1230, or CO2.

    •Experience commissioning gaseous suppression systems.

    What is on offer

    • Competitive salary of £40,000 per annum.

    • Company van, tools, PPE, and all equipment provided.

    • Structured on call rota with full support.

    • Supportive management team with extensive industry experience.

    • Career progression opportunities into senior and supervisory positions.
